Chapter Thirty-Four

Part One









Bella woke up to the sun shining into her eyes from the condo window. She rose from the bed without waking Don and left the room to walk out to the beach.










She found herself thinking about Pascal. Sweet, serious Pascal. He had always been so helpful to her, and now she had left town and left him hanging. It seemed wrong to have gone away without even saying goodbye.

Had she been too hasty in accepting Don's offer?






It was also troubling to her that she could no longer work on recalling her memories. Without the use of Pascal's noodlesoother, she didn't seem to be getting anywhere with them, and that was disappointing. She had been making some real progress. Now she'd probably be stalled the way she was, without any idea about her true identity.

She sighed, listening to the sounds of the waves, and resigned herself to the situation. The sun was warm on her face and the salt air smelled fresh. Why worry about it?




Then suddenly, she was reminded of the dream she had the previous night. It had been a terrible, frightening dream. A nightmare, really.




She had been in a dark room, lying on a bed or some sort of cot, with not even enough strength to lift her head.

There had been two figures in the room, and they had been arguing over something.

"No, that one isn't different enough!" bellowed the harsh male voice. "You need something that won't be recognized."




"What we need is something bland and nondescript." The woman corrected. Her tone was calm and controlled. "Something easily forgotten."

The woman picked up a book, and read the title aloud, "Making Faces: 28 templates for plastic surgery." The woman's hands flipped to the first page after the table of contents, and she read aloud, "Face one... small and round, with petite features. Pleasing and bland. Everyone likes this facial structure. You can't go wrong with face one."




"Sounds boring," the man huffed, "You should give her some distinction. A proud brow or nose, like mine!"

"No, this is perfect," she said. "She will blend in, beautiful yet unremarkable. It's exactly what the doctor, and the doctor's patron, ordered. Face one it is!"




The woman walked towards her.

"Rise and shine, dear," she said, with a syrupy sweet voice. "It's time for your makeover."

Bella felt a terror rising up within her and struggled to escape, but she was frozen. The woman towered over her, like the old hag of nightmares, ready to push the breath and very life from her.

"You know, I haven't done this before," she admitted, "but I'll assure you I'm a quick learner. If anything gets horribly botched in the process, I'm sure I can fix you up in no time."




Again, Bella struggled. She felt increasing amounts of fear rising up inside of her. She burned all over.

"Just a snip here... a slice here..."

The terror grew, consuming her. She struggled and struggled but could not move. The woman's laughter echoed through the room.

"It won't hurt a bit..."




Then she woke up.




It was just a nightmare. The old hag had come to smother her and take her. Maybe the dream had come from her frustration with not knowing who she was, of having a face that she didn't recognize as her own.




It was just a dream; nothing to worry about.

Just a dream.

Just a dream.

Just a dream.




Just a dream?


Samantha Cordial watched her niece and her thoughts in the depths of her cauldron.




She had been following her with interest ever since they had located her, and this new development was puzzling to her.

Had it really been just a dream or had it been a true memory?










Behind her, Kimberly materialized. "How is she, dear sister?" she asked.




"She seems to be doing fine," Samantha said, "and she does have amnesia, as I suspected, but it's not an enchantment. I can't determine what caused her memories to vanish. Now I'm getting readings of some sort of memories from her, but they're all very cloudy and indistinct. I don't understand them."

"Well, I am certain it will all be made clear to you, eventually."

"I hope so, sister, but progress is very slow." After a pause, she asked, "How is your work going?"




"Oh, it's going very well, I would say."

"Have you spotted him recently?"

"Yes, I have. He's been increasingly active."

"That's troubling."




"Not to worry! My cauldron has located him in the capital city. I'll be tracking him all day. I'll get to the bottom of this. Of that I have no doubt."

"Good luck in your travels."

She nodded in return. "And good luck to you as well." Without another word, Kimberly vanished.








With her sister gone, Samantha returned to her work.
